Identifying Slug and Snail Damage

The first step in effective slug and snail control is accurately identifying the damage they cause. Slugs and snails feed on living plant tissue, leaving distinctive trails of slime wherever they travel. This slime, while appearing innocuous, can contribute to the spread of plant diseases. The types of damage vary depending on the plant and the severity of the infestation. Young seedlings are particularly vulnerable, often being completely devoured overnight. Larger plants may exhibit irregular holes in leaves, or have their fruits and vegetables scarred and disfigured. Pay close attention to plants known to be slug and snail favorites, such as hostas, lettuces, and strawberries, as these are often the first to show signs of attack. Observing damage patterns – such as feeding occurring predominantly at night, or concentrated around moist, sheltered areas – can further confirm the presence of these pests.

Recognizing Different Species

While often lumped together, various slug and snail species exhibit slightly different behaviors and preferences. Common garden slugs, such as the black slug and the brown garden slug, are widespread throughout the UK. The Spanish slug, however, is a particularly problematic invasive species known for its large size and voracious appetite. Similarly, different snail species, like the garden snail and the grove snail, vary in their habits and the types of plants they favor. Accurate species identification is not always essential for basic control measures, but it can be helpful for understanding pest dynamics and tailoring treatments. Resources like field guides and online identification tools can assist gardeners in distinguishing between common species. Knowing which species are prevalent in your area can help you anticipate potential problems and implement targeted strategies.

Pest Common Damage Favored Plants Control Methods
Garden Slug Irregular holes in leaves, slime trails Lettuce, Hostas, Seedlings Beer traps, copper tape, nematodes
Spanish Slug Extensive leaf damage, fruit scarring Wide range, especially vegetables Handpicking, barriers, iron phosphate
Garden Snail Rounded holes, slime trails, shell fragments Hostas, Cabbage, Strawberries Handpicking, barriers, slug pellets
Grove Snail Similar to Garden Snail, prefers sheltered locations Ornamental plants, shrubs Encourage predators, remove hiding places

Understanding the specific pest you’re dealing with allows for a more refined approach to control. For example, Spanish slugs are known to be less attracted to traditional slug pellets, requiring alternative solutions like iron phosphate-based products.

Preventative Measures for a Slug-Free Garden

Prevention is often the most effective strategy for managing slugs and snails. Creating an unfavorable environment for them can significantly reduce their numbers and minimize damage. This starts with garden hygiene. Removing dead leaves, weeds, and other debris eliminates potential hiding places where slugs and snails can shelter during the day. Reducing moisture levels is also crucial, as slugs and snails thrive in damp conditions. Improving drainage, avoiding overwatering, and ensuring good air circulation can all help to create a drier environment. Furthermore, certain plants act as natural barriers or repellents. Strongly scented herbs like garlic and mint can deter slugs and snails, while plants with rough or hairy leaves are less appealing to them. The principles of companion planting can therefore play a vital role in preventative slug management.

Creating Physical Barriers

Physical barriers can effectively prevent slugs and snails from reaching vulnerable plants. Copper tape, when applied around pots or raised beds, creates a mild electrical charge that deters them. This is because the slime they produce reacts with the copper, causing discomfort. Other effective barriers include grit, crushed eggshells, or diatomaceous earth, which create a rough surface that slugs and snails find difficult to navigate. These materials need to be reapplied regularly, especially after rain. Protecting individual plants with cloches or collars can also provide a physical barrier against attack. These preventative measures, when implemented consistently, can significantly reduce the need for more drastic control methods.

Biological Control and Encouraging Natural Predators

Utilizing natural predators and biological control agents offers an environmentally friendly approach to slug and snail management. Several species of birds, frogs, toads, hedgehogs, and ground beetles prey on slugs and snails. Encouraging these beneficial creatures in your garden can help to keep slug populations in check. Providing suitable habitats, such as bird feeders, ponds, and piles of leaves, can attract these natural predators. Nematodes, microscopic worms, are also commercially available as a biological control agent. These nematodes parasitize slugs and snails, ultimately killing them. Applying nematodes to the soil is an effective way to reduce slug populations, particularly in enclosed spaces like greenhouses. However, it's important to note that nematodes are most effective when applied to moist soil and at the correct temperature.

Introducing Nematodes

Nematodes are living organisms and require specific conditions to thrive. They are best applied in spring or autumn when soil temperatures are above 5°C. The soil should be moist, but not waterlogged. Nematodes are typically applied as a liquid drench, and it’s essential to follow the instructions on the product packaging carefully. Repeat applications may be necessary to achieve optimal results, as nematodes have a limited lifespan. While nematodes are generally safe for other wildlife and pets, it’s always advisable to avoid direct contact with the treated area during application. Organic and Commercial Control Options

When preventative measures and biological controls are insufficient, gardeners may turn to organic or commercial control options. Organic slug pellets, based on iron phosphate, are a safer alternative to traditional metaldehyde-based pellets, which can be toxic to pets and wildlife. Iron phosphate pellets disrupt the slugs’ digestive system, causing them to stop feeding and eventually die. Another organic option is beer traps. Slugs are attracted to the scent of beer and will drown in the trap. However, beer traps can also attract beneficial insects, so careful placement is important. Commercial slug and snail baits containing metaldehyde are highly effective but should be used with caution, following the instructions on the packaging carefully.
